Kim Munil
Capital Division
Corporal
Corporal Kim Munil was born in Sangsan-ri, Hamyang-myeon, Hamyang-gun, Gyeongsangnam-do, jul. 29, 1947. He was assigned to 3rd Company, 1st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Corporal Kim Munil died from an enemy’s sniper shooting during combat in Phu Cat(Br936392) Jan. 23, 1968. He was awarded the Order of Military Merit Hwarang. He was buried at 26-2-1490 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
Mun Gwuangseong
Capital Division
Sergeant
Sergeant Mun Gwuangseong was born in 574 Songjeong-ri, Songjeong-eup, Gwuangsan-gun, Jeollanam-do, jan. 7, 1945. He was assigned to 3rd Company, 1st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Sergeant Mun Gwuangseong died from an enemy’s sniper shooting during combat in Phu Cat(Br936392) Jan. 23, 1968. He was awarded the Order of Military Merit Hwarang. He was buried at 26-1-1596 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
Hwang Byoungsik
Capital Division
Private
Private 1st Class Hwang Byoungsik was born in 289 Seomi-ri, Pungsan-myeon, Adong-gun, Gyeongsangnam-do, Apr. 20, 1944. He was assigned to 3rd Company, 1st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Private 1st Class Hwang Byoungsik died from an enemy’s sniper shooting during a battle in Phu Cat(Br935393) Jan. 24, 1968. He was awarded the Order of Military Merit Inheon. He was buried at 1-146-41056 soldier graveyard in Daejeon National Cemetery.
Lee Manjoo
Capital Division
Staff Sergeant
Staff Sergeant Lee Manjoo was born in 422 Bujeon2-dong, Busanjin-gu, Busan City, Jan. 8, 1943. He was assigned to 3rd Company, 1st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Staff Sergeant Lee Manjoo died in a hospital Feb. 9, 1968, from wounds caused by shrapnels during Tiger Operation 9 in the area of Phu Cat, Nui Ba(CR014418). He was awarded the Order of Military Merit Hwarang. He was buried at 26-1-1661 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
Hong Gidae
Capital Division
Staff Sergeant
Staff Sergeant Hong Gidae was born in 786 Seongseok-ri, Byeokje-myeon, Goyang-gun, Gyeonggi-do, Jun. 17, 1944. He was assigned to 3rd Company, 1st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Staff Sergeant Hong Gidae died in a hospital Sep. 29, 1968, from wounds caused by shrapnels during a military operation in Phuoc Hiep, Song Cay. He was awarded the Order of Military Merit Hwarang. He was buried at 21-1-2178 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
